You know things are not going well for the Turkish government when you hear their desperate attempts at hiding the real perpetrators behind the Ankara terrorist attacks. Maybe they don’t even try anymore and have decided to make fun of the situation. It may be funny if there were not 128 dead bodies and body parts lying around in pools of blood. There were times when the Turkish state would try to explain away its crimes, but at least what was said had a slight chance of being taken seriously. This time around the Turkish state went from ridiculousness to outright stupidity.
First of all, when the bombs hit the pro-peace rally a handful of police standing guard at the very outskirts immediately fled. They even left their cars abandoned with the keys hanging in the ignition. Although the police disappeared from the scene at the time the bombs exploded, a mob of cops at the other side of the street closed the road and prevented the ambulances from reaching the dead and the more than 500 wounded. Calling for help, screaming for someone to take a seriously injured man bleeding on the ground, two activists from the popular left organization Peoples’ Houses waited for an ambulance to arrive. However, the police were holding the ambulances from reaching the square. So, the activists looked around and they were able to spot couple of abandoned police vehicles. There was one police car that had been driven into the crowd by a fleeing cop. That did not but another abandoned police vehicle had the keys dangling from the ignition. The police were gone and they needed a car to rush the dying patient to the hospital. They took the police car, loaded the bleeding man and drove off, headed for the hospital. On the way, when they saw a group of police at an intersection they stopped and told the police what had happened and what they were doing. Both were immediately arrested for transporting a wounded person to the hospital. Did we mention that in the last 3 recent massacres in Turkey, all against the opponents of the government, not a single person was even named as a suspect, forget being arrested.
Things even go downhill from there.
During the hours that followed the blasts, close to 500 wounded were taken to the nearby hospitals. Many lives were saved due to nurses and doctors associations participating in the rally. Health care workers already in the plaza immediately started helping the wounded. During this time the police finally reached the square but while still not allowing the ambulances to get through, started pepper spraying the wounded and the dying. Although the Turkish state later denied the report of gassing the victims, videos taken at the scene show the police action at work that leaves no doubt on how they targeted the people on the ground with tear and pepper gas. But even under these conditions Turkish state named the suspects. The guilty, we are told by the state, were those who needlessly sent calls for blood donations to the wounded! It was earlier reported how the government tried stopping any blood donations by announcing there was no need for blood. Now, the Ministry of Health officials inform us that those who asked blood donations were not health officials and because of them 150 people lined up to give blood. And, we are told, due to people who donated blood, the entire hospital systems came to a gridlock and services were not provided to those in need. Now that the criminals were identified, the Ministry of Health is working with the prosecutor’s office for a crime investigation against those who asked people to donate blood.
Did we also mention that the Prime Minister Ahmet Davudoglu announced today that the government had information, names and addresses of a gang of ISIL terrorists who received training from a high ranking jihadist bomb expert on how to assemble a bomb and attack crowds. However, these would be suicide bombers, said the Prime Minister, would not be arrested before they exploded a bomb in a crowd! You see, Turkey is a country of law and order.
